      7 /* Constants and formulas that affect speed-ratio trade-offs and thus define
      8    quality levels. */
      9 
     10 #ifndef BROTLI_ENC_QUALITY_H_
     11 #define BROTLI_ENC_QUALITY_H_
     12 
     13 #include "../common/platform.h"
     14 #include <brotli/encode.h>
     15 #include "./params.h"
     16 
     17 #define FAST_ONE_PASS_COMPRESSION_QUALITY 0
     18 #define FAST_TWO_PASS_COMPRESSION_QUALITY 1
     19 #define ZOPFLIFICATION_QUALITY 10
     20 #define HQ_ZOPFLIFICATION_QUALITY 11
     21 
     22 #define MAX_QUALITY_FOR_STATIC_ENTROPY_CODES 2
     23 #define MIN_QUALITY_FOR_BLOCK_SPLIT 4
     24 #define MIN_QUALITY_FOR_NONZERO_DISTANCE_PARAMS 4
     25 #define MIN_QUALITY_FOR_OPTIMIZE_HISTOGRAMS 4
     26 #define MIN_QUALITY_FOR_EXTENSIVE_REFERENCE_SEARCH 5
     27 #define MIN_QUALITY_FOR_CONTEXT_MODELING 5
     28 #define MIN_QUALITY_FOR_HQ_CONTEXT_MODELING 7
     29 #define MIN_QUALITY_FOR_HQ_BLOCK_SPLITTING 10
     30 
     31 /* For quality below MIN_QUALITY_FOR_BLOCK_SPLIT there is no block splitting,
     32    so we buffer at most this much literals and commands. */
     33 #define MAX_NUM_DELAYED_SYMBOLS 0x2FFF
     34 
     35 /* Returns hash-table size for quality levels 0 and 1. */
     36 static BROTLI_INLINE size_t MaxHashTableSize(int quality) {
     37   return quality == FAST_ONE_PASS_COMPRESSION_QUALITY ? 1 << 15 : 1 << 17;
     38 }
     39 
     40 /* The maximum length for which the zopflification uses distinct distances. */
     41 #define MAX_ZOPFLI_LEN_QUALITY_10 150
     42 #define MAX_ZOPFLI_LEN_QUALITY_11 325
     43 
     44 /* Do not thoroughly search when a long copy is found. */
     45 #define BROTLI_LONG_COPY_QUICK_STEP 16384
     46 
     47 static BROTLI_INLINE size_t MaxZopfliLen(const BrotliEncoderParams* params) {
     48   return params->quality <= 10 ?
     49       MAX_ZOPFLI_LEN_QUALITY_10 :
     50       MAX_ZOPFLI_LEN_QUALITY_11;
     51 }
     52 
     53 /* Number of best candidates to evaluate to expand Zopfli chain. */
     54 static BROTLI_INLINE size_t MaxZopfliCandidates(
     55   const BrotliEncoderParams* params) {
     56   return params->quality <= 10 ? 1 : 5;
     57 }
     58 
     59 static BROTLI_INLINE void SanitizeParams(BrotliEncoderParams* params) {
     60   params->quality = BROTLI_MIN(int, BROTLI_MAX_QUALITY,
     61       BROTLI_MAX(int, BROTLI_MIN_QUALITY, params->quality));
     62   if (params->quality <= MAX_QUALITY_FOR_STATIC_ENTROPY_CODES) {
     63     params->large_window = BROTLI_FALSE;
     64   }
     65   if (params->lgwin < BROTLI_MIN_WINDOW_BITS) {
     66     params->lgwin = BROTLI_MIN_WINDOW_BITS;
     67   } else {
     68     int max_lgwin = params->large_window ? BROTLI_LARGE_MAX_WINDOW_BITS :
     69                                            BROTLI_MAX_WINDOW_BITS;
     70     if (params->lgwin > max_lgwin) params->lgwin = max_lgwin;
     71   }
     72 }
     73 
     74 /* Returns optimized lg_block value. */
     75 static BROTLI_INLINE int ComputeLgBlock(const BrotliEncoderParams* params) {
     76   int lgblock = params->lgblock;
     77   if (params->quality == FAST_ONE_PASS_COMPRESSION_QUALITY ||
     78       params->quality == FAST_TWO_PASS_COMPRESSION_QUALITY) {
     79     lgblock = params->lgwin;
     80   } else if (params->quality < MIN_QUALITY_FOR_BLOCK_SPLIT) {
     81     lgblock = 14;
     82   } else if (lgblock == 0) {
     83     lgblock = 16;
     84     if (params->quality >= 9 && params->lgwin > lgblock) {
     85       lgblock = BROTLI_MIN(int, 18, params->lgwin);
     86     }
     87   } else {
     88     lgblock = BROTLI_MIN(int, BROTLI_MAX_INPUT_BLOCK_BITS,
     89         BROTLI_MAX(int, BROTLI_MIN_INPUT_BLOCK_BITS, lgblock));
     90   }
     91   return lgblock;
     92 }
     93 
     94 /* Returns log2 of the size of main ring buffer area.
     95    Allocate at least lgwin + 1 bits for the ring buffer so that the newly
     96    added block fits there completely and we still get lgwin bits and at least
     97    read_block_size_bits + 1 bits because the copy tail length needs to be
     98    smaller than ring-buffer size. */
     99 static BROTLI_INLINE int ComputeRbBits(const BrotliEncoderParams* params) {
    100   return 1 + BROTLI_MAX(int, params->lgwin, params->lgblock);
    101 }
    102 
    103 static BROTLI_INLINE size_t MaxMetablockSize(
    104     const BrotliEncoderParams* params) {
    105   int bits =
    106       BROTLI_MIN(int, ComputeRbBits(params), BROTLI_MAX_INPUT_BLOCK_BITS);
    107   return (size_t)1 << bits;
    108 }
    109 
    110 /* When searching for backward references and have not seen matches for a long
    111    time, we can skip some match lookups. Unsuccessful match lookups are very
    112    expensive and this kind of a heuristic speeds up compression quite a lot.
    113    At first 8 byte strides are taken and every second byte is put to hasher.
    114    After 4x more literals stride by 16 bytes, every put 4-th byte to hasher.
    115    Applied only to qualities 2 to 9. */
    116 static BROTLI_INLINE size_t LiteralSpreeLengthForSparseSearch(
    117     const BrotliEncoderParams* params) {
    118   return params->quality < 9 ? 64 : 512;
    119 }
    120 
    121 static BROTLI_INLINE void ChooseHasher(const BrotliEncoderParams* params,
    122                                        BrotliHasherParams* hparams) {
    123   if (params->quality > 9) {
    124     hparams->type = 10;
    125   } else if (params->quality == 4 && params->size_hint >= (1 << 20)) {
    126     hparams->type = 54;
    127   } else if (params->quality < 5) {
    128     hparams->type = params->quality;
    129   } else if (params->lgwin <= 16) {
    130     hparams->type = params->quality < 7 ? 40 : params->quality < 9 ? 41 : 42;
    131   } else if (params->size_hint >= (1 << 20) && params->lgwin >= 19) {
    132     hparams->type = 6;
    133     hparams->block_bits = params->quality - 1;
    134     hparams->bucket_bits = 15;
    135     hparams->hash_len = 5;
    136     hparams->num_last_distances_to_check =
    137         params->quality < 7 ? 4 : params->quality < 9 ? 10 : 16;
    138   } else {
    139     hparams->type = 5;
    140     hparams->block_bits = params->quality - 1;
    141     hparams->bucket_bits = params->quality < 7 ? 14 : 15;
    142     hparams->num_last_distances_to_check =
    143         params->quality < 7 ? 4 : params->quality < 9 ? 10 : 16;
    144   }
    145 
    146   if (params->lgwin > 24) {
    147     /* Different hashers for large window brotli: not for qualities <= 2,
    148        these are too fast for large window. Not for qualities >= 10: their
    149        hasher already works well with large window. So the changes are:
    150        H3 --> H35: for quality 3.
    151        H54 --> H55: for quality 4 with size hint > 1MB
    152        H6 --> H65: for qualities 5, 6, 7, 8, 9. */
    153     if (hparams->type == 3) {
    154       hparams->type = 35;
    155     }
    156     if (hparams->type == 54) {
    157       hparams->type = 55;
    158     }
    159     if (hparams->type == 6) {
    160       hparams->type = 65;
    161     }
    162   }
    163 }
    164 
    165 #endif  /* BROTLI_ENC_QUALITY_H_ */
